Letter from the Pastor
Welcome
to Mt. Hermon Lutheran Church! For over 125 years, Mt. Hermon
has been a community of faith, worship, and service in the
name of Jesus Christ. As a guest, joining us for worship,
we invite you to participate in every area of our congregational
life, as you feel comfortable. Whether this is your first
time here at Mt. Hermon or your first visit to any church,
you are welcome here. Feel free to explore our ministries
and your faith at your own peace. All programs, classes,
and groups are open to you. If you are a parent, feel free
to bring your children to any of our youth or children's
programs. You are encouraged to ask questions about your
faith or ours, and we hope you will feel safe to grow in
your spirituality and the blessings of our Lord. We are
a congregation of the North Carolina Synod of the Evangelical
Lutheran Church in America (ELCA),
and a covenant church of Bread for the World. These affiliations
signify our commitment to worshipping God and helping people
in need; as well as our commitment to be a place where everyone
feels loved and welcome.
Once again, welcome to Mt. Hermon Lutheran Church.
